2007 SsangYong Musso vs. 1987 Acura Integra

To start off, 2007 SsangYong Musso is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Acura Integra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Acura Integra would be higher. At 2,873 cc (5 cylinders), 2007 SsangYong Musso is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1987 Acura Integra (125 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 7 more horse power than 2007 SsangYong Musso. (118 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1987 Acura Integra should accelerate faster than 2007 SsangYong Musso.

Because 2007 SsangYong Musso is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1987 Acura Integra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 SsangYong Musso will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 SsangYong Musso (250 Nm @ 2250 RPM) has 111 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Acura Integra. (139 Nm @ 5500 RPM). This means 2007 SsangYong Musso will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Acura Integra.
